Noel Marquez, left, Ronnie Null, center, and Betty Jo Allen prepare to judge an entry in the Recycled Art Show today at the Artesia Historical Museum Art Annex Gallery. Entries are required to be composed of at least 75 percent recycled materials for the contest. Artists incorporated everything from old T-shirts and aluminum cans to the denim used in the dress pictured above. An open house reception is scheduled for 5-7 p.m. Friday, Feb. 18, at the Art Annex Gallery on Richardson Avenue. The show is sponsored by Artesia Clean & Beautiful. (Ashley Trujillo - Daily Press)
